Precision Protection for Power-Hungry Systems
Designed for high-current applications up to 1000V DC, this 690VAC/1000VDC-rated fuse delivers ultra-rapid protection with breaking capacity exceeding 100kA. Its 9URD33TTF1000 designation isn’t just alphabet soup – it encodes its 33mm diameter body and time-current characteristics optimized for semiconductor protection.

The Numbers Don’t Lie
Parameter | Performance |
---|---|
Response Time | <2ms at 200% rating |
Energy Limitation | I²t ≤ 0.6 x 10^6 A²s |
Operating Temp | -40°C to +125°C |
